A Distinguished Legal Team With Deep Local Roots And A Reputation For Excellence

Our legal team, which includes business lawyers, family law lawyers, real estate lawyers and others, deftly mixes highly capable associates with respected veteran attorneys with decades of experience. With two retired superior court judges on our team, it is hard to find a law firm in the area with a more ongoing passion for and knowledge of the law. From litigation to mediation, our accomplished North Carolina firm represents clients in a range of legal matters, including business transactions, family law concerns, criminal charges and estate administration. We have a reputation as effective litigators, with a long track record of success that has helped build our reputation throughout the state.

Civil Litigation
Family Law
Criminal Law

Wills & Estate

Business Law
Real Estate Law and

Eminent Domain/Land

Business And
Shareholder Litigation

A Down-To-Earth Approach

Some people associate lawyers with stress and aggression. That’s not our style. We are an accessible firm grounded in passion for what we do while maintaining an appreciation for the human connection that makes practicing law rewarding. We pride ourselves on maintaining a high standard of professionalism with a gracious and welcoming atmosphere that yields return clients. We respectfully represent a wide range of clients, from farmers to corporate CEOs. We are rightfully more concerned with your rights than your rank, and look forward to learning how we can help you achieve a favorable resolution for your concerns.

Connect With One Of Our Trusted Attorneys

Let’s Have A Conversation

Whatever legal situation you face, our astute attorneys can provide a nuanced perspective of where you stand and what your options are. We don’t tell you what to do, but ensure that you have the right information so you can make a decision that’s in your best interest. To connect with one of the trusted attorneys at our firm, call 828-328-2596 or 866-784-9938 toll free or reach out using our online contact form.